Unfortunatly, in this case the .cdg file is NOT identical to a .bin file. The .cdg files used in mp3+g are very different from the .cdg files that Microstudio creates and uses. I wasn't aware MTU had a conversion program to change mp3+g to .cdg files. I do know of a different company who has a mp3+g to .bin decoder. And once you use this program, you can then just rename the file extension from .bin to .cdg, you must make sure that explorer is set to display file extensions.
